Tracking Customers Year Over Year
Hello I was wondering if anyone had any suggestions as to how I could track a customer ID#, date, and product type, to put together a list of which customer's are returning year after year, and how many items they are purchasing? I have the data captured but do not know how to display this visually... Thanks for the help!

MAIL # Purchase Date Product Type 354 10/7/2016 Day Pass 214 10/8/2017 Night Pass 215 11/1/2017 Day Pass 789 11/1/2017 Day Pass 485 11/1/2017 Night Pass 784 2/6/2015 Day Pass 784 2/6/2015 Day Pass 784 2/6/2015 Day Pass 354 10/7/2017 Day Pass 215 10/9/2015 Day Pass 789 10/1/2014 Night Pass 354 10/7/2018 Day Pass 214 10/8/2015 Night Pass
Thank you for the responses. Above is the data that I would like to have analyzed...I am hoping to get results that look something like this...Year Total Customers by Mail # Number of Products Purchased New Customers Returning Customers 2015 15 33 15 0 2016 20 30 16 4 2017 30 55 15 15 2018 100 350 75 25
I would also be interested in Identifying specific customers by Mail# that held a pass in one given year, did not return the following year, but still returned at a later date.
